Ok, here's the skinny. You can only do one or the other because there both through true car an you can only use I true car coupon code. Pen fed is 1000 an Sam's is 500. You have to go on the web sites an print them out. I wish I could tell you how to do it but just like other rebates, they don't make it easy. My wife an I worked on the pen fed one for about 30 minutes of just clicking on different things but eventually stumbled upon it. But 30 minutes for a G ain't to bad. Sam's was allot easier to do online but at the time I didn't know that you could only use one from true car. There's both good until early 2021 not sure of exact month. If you served in the military or a close reflective has served you can get into pen fed that way. There's also a loop hole that says people not from the military can become members by simply making a $5 dollar donation online. Yes 5 Not 500. The 5 goes into your acct that you have to open. Then after a few days you will be able to get acct info to get you started. I did mine about 9 months ago an used it 1 month ago, just because I had decided to wait for 2020s.
